So, what is vitamin b1?

Vitamin B1, also known as thiamine, is a water-soluble vitamin that plays a crucial role in the proper functioning of the body. Thiamine is an essential nutrient that cannot be produced by the body, which means it must be obtained through diet or supplements. Thiamine is necessary for the metabolism of carbohydrates, which are the body's main source of energy. It helps convert carbohydrates into glucose, which can then be used by the body for energy. Thiamine is also involved in the metabolism of amino acids and fats, which are important for building and repairing tissues, as well as for maintaining healthy skin, hair, and eyes. In addition to its role in energy production, thiamine is also important for maintaining a healthy nervous system. It helps produce neurotransmitters, which are chemical messengers that are involved in communication between nerve cells. Thiamine is also needed for the proper functioning of the brain, as it helps to maintain normal cognitive function and improve memory. Thiamine deficiency can lead to a number of health problems, including beriberi, a condition that affects the cardiovascular and nervous systems. Beriberi can cause symptoms such as muscle weakness, fatigue, and difficulty breathing. Severe thiamine deficiency can also lead to a condition called Wernicke-Korsakoff syndrome, which is characterized by confusion, memory loss, and difficulty with coordination. Fortunately, thiamine deficiency is rare in developed countries, as it is found in a wide variety of foods. Some of the best dietary sources of thiamine include whole grains, legumes, nuts, and seeds. Meats, fish, and dairy products also contain thiamine, although to a lesser extent. Thiamine is also available in supplement form, either on its own or as part of a vitamin B complex. While most people are able to get enough thiamine through their diet, certain groups of people may be at risk of thiamine deficiency. These include people who consume large amounts of alcohol, those with gastrointestinal disorders, and those who have undergone bariatric surgery. It is recommended that adult men and women consume 1.1mg and 0.8mg of thiamine per day, respectively. Pregnant and breastfeeding women may require higher amounts. Thiamine is a water-soluble vitamin, meaning that excess amounts are excreted in the urine rather than stored in the body, making toxicity rare. In addition to thiamine-rich foods, there are also foods that can interfere with thiamine absorption. For example, raw fish and shellfish contain an enzyme called thiaminase, which can break down thiamine in the body. Additionally, certain foods such as tea and coffee contain compounds that can reduce thiamine absorption. While these foods are not harmful in moderation, it is important to be mindful of their potential impact on thiamine status.
